In this manner, what does Karahi curry taste like?

Chicken karahi masala (sauce) gets much of its flavor from garlic, ginger, and red chilies. There are lots of warming spices in this dish, as well as chiles. But, it doesn’t have to be mouth-flaming hot. Choose your chili based on your heat preference.

Just so, why is it called Chicken Karahi? The word karahi in its name refers to a thick and deep cooking-pot similar to a wok in which the dish is prepared. Apart from chicken, the dish is made with red chili powder, cumin, garam masala, ginger, allspice, cardamom, tomatoes, and garlic.

Is karahi same as curry?

>>Karahi curry is named after the steep-sided, wok-like pot in which this dish would traditionally be cooked. ‘Karahi’ is the Hindi name for the pot but they’re also known as a kadai, korai or kadhi and are used for shallow or deep frying or to slow cook curries throughout India, Pakistan and Bangladesh.>>

Is karahi the same as korai?

The actual meaning of Korai or karahi is an Indian cooking pot made from cast iron, very similar to a wok. Karahi dishes are an Indian style of cooking rather than a traditional recipe, so you’ll find the restaurant versions can vary significantly. But the basic ingredients will be the same throughout.

What’s the difference between Balti and karahi?

A Karahi is actually the name for a type of Indian iron round bottomed wok in the same way that a Balti is a flat bottomed metal dish too.

Is Rogan Josh spicy?

Rogan Josh is firmly in the category of a medium curry. On a scale of 1 – 10, with 1 being a mild curry and 10 being hot, Rogan Josh is a solid 4. The dish does include chilli but in relatively small quantities. It also contains yoghurt, which brings the spice level down to a manageable level.

How spicy is a karahi?

Generally it will be served medium to hot but we have seen milder versions too. A Karahi is actually the name for a type of Indian iron round bottomed wok. As mentioned the Karahi style is similar to a Balti curry, however the Karahi is commonly available as a dish in its own right.

Who invented karahi?

Karahi is believed to have originated specifically from Khyber Pakhtunkhwa which is formerly the northern frontier of Pakistan. Chicken karahi is unique and the distinguishing features are its tomato like base and its fragrance as well as the finishing cilantro, green chili peppers, and slivers of ginger.
